Route Options

Fastest Route: I-185 S

If you're looking to get to Phenix City in the shortest amount of time possible, then the fastest route for you is to take I-185 S. This 40-mile drive will take you straight down the highway, allowing you to reach your destination in a breeze. With minimal stops and traffic lights, this route is perfect for those who are in a hurry.

Most Scenic Route: GA-219 S

For those of you who enjoy taking the scenic route and soaking in the natural beauty along the way, GA-219 S is the perfect choice. This 45-mile drive will treat you to picturesque countryside views, charming little towns, and lovely farmlands. While this route may take a bit longer than the fastest option, the journey itself is well worth the extra time.

Travel Distance and Time Estimates

Now that we've highlighted the fastest and most scenic routes, let's dive into the estimated travel distances and times for each option.

  • Fastest Route:

    • Distance: 40 miles
    • Driving Time (Peak Traffic): Approximately 45 minutes
    • Driving Time (Low Traffic): Approximately 35 minutes
  • Scenic Route:

    • Distance: 45 miles
    • Driving Time (Peak Traffic): Approximately 55 minutes
    • Driving Time (Low Traffic): Approximately 40 minutes
